Florida Grand Opera’s exciting production of Gounod’s Roméo et Juliette stars French tenor Sébastien Guèze as Roméo. Sébastien sang his first Roméoin 2008 with the Concertgebouw of Amsterdam and has been called “one of the most promising young tenors of his generation” by Opera News. He has also received numerous honors, among them the Audience Prize in Plácido Domingo’s Operalia competition and the “Revelation of the Year” award at the Victoires de la Musique ceremony in 2009.
Sébastien made his Florida Grand Opera debut in David DiChiera's Cyrano, where he unveiled a new aria for the role of Christian, delivering it with "a real leading man's voice … [and] a depth and emotional edge that gave the character integrity," according to South Florida Classical Review.
